Tottenham star extremely worried ahead of Arsenal clash

Arsenal may have had to settle for a last minute winner against Ludgorets on Tuesday, but this weekend’s rivals Tottenham were embarrassed by a home defeat against Bundesliga side Bayer Leverkusen, and with their injury list piling up as well, their goalkeeper Hugo Lloris is very worried about the state of the team.

Lloris said in the Telegraph: “We cannot be in a worse situation. It is difficult to accept that kind of performance from us. It was difficult to recognise the team, very aggressive, very calm under pressure, and that was completely the opposite.

“We need to learn quickly because there is a big game in Sunday. The derby is always important and we need to forget about this disappointment and be ready.”

Arsenal have a few injuries, but the Spuds are in a much worse situation right now with Harry Kane, Mousa Dembele, Alderweireld, Erik Lamela and Danny Rose all out, although Kane may have recovered enough to be on the bench against us. Lloris doesn’t think they should blame that on the reason for the defeat at Wembley. “We cannot depend on one, two or three players. We need to think as a team,” he said. “In football there are ups and downs. It is difficult because this game was every important and I did not feel we were aware of that. Leverkusen did not play a great game. They were just well-organised and had some chances because of us, because we made too many mistakes.”
